How Our Crawl Space Water Extraction Process Works
A proper crawl space water extraction process needs careful planning and execution. Our team uses specialized equipment, including moisture meters and drying fans, to ensure a thorough and efficient removal of water and moisture. We’ll also identify and address any underlying issues, such as poor drainage or structural damage, to prevent future problems.
Step 1: Assessment and Containment
Our technicians will arrive on-site and assess the damage, identifying the source of the water and the extent of the damage. We’ll then contain the area to prevent further water entry and damage.
Step 2: Water Removal
Using specialized equipment, including submersible pumps and wet/dry vacuums, we’ll remove the standing water from the crawl space. This process typically takes 2-4 hours, depending on the size of the area and the amount of water present.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
With the water removed, our team will use drying fans and dehumidifiers to reduce the moisture levels in the crawl space. This process can take anywhere from 3-5 days, depending on the ambient temperature and humidity.
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fecting
Once the crawl space is dry, our technicians will clean and disinfect the area to prevent mold and mildew growth. This includes removing any damaged insulation, debris, or other materials.
Step 5: Repair and Restoration
Finally, our team will repair any damaged structures, including walls, floors, and ceilings, and restore the crawl space to its original condition.

Warning Signs You Need Crawl Space Water Extraction
Crawl space water damage can be a ticking time bomb, causing costly repairs and health risks if left unchecked. Look out for these warning signs to prevent a major disaster: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Musty smells are a clear indication of mold and mildew growth. If you notice a persistent odor in your crawl space, it’s time to call us.
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ings
Water stains can be a sign of a larger issue, such as a leaky pipe or poor drainage. Don’t ignore these signs, or you may face costly repairs down the line.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or poor installation. Our team can assess the issue and provide a solution.
Increased Humidity and Moisture
High humidity and moisture levels in your crawl space can lead to mold and mildew growth. We’ll help you identify the source of the issue and provide a solution.
Unusual Sounds or Sights
Unusual sounds or sights in your crawl space, such as dripping water or unusual odors, can be a sign of a larger issue. Don’t ignore these signs, or you may face costly repairs.
Visible Water Damage
Visible water damage, such as standing water or water stains, is a clear indication of a problem. Our team will assess the damage and provide a solution.
Crawl Space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water leak, contained in a small area | Yes | No | You can likely handle the issue on your own with some DIY equipment. |
| Large water leak, affecting multiple areas | No | Yes | This need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age. |
| Visible mold or mildew growth | No | Yes | Mold and mildew need specialized cleaning and disinfecting to prevent health risks. |
| Water damage affecting structural elements | No | Yes | This needs specialized expertise to prevent further damage and ensure safety. |
| Water damage in a confined space, such as a crawl space | No | Yes | This need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ure safety. |
